Demographic pressures, donor fatigue, inflation, rising labour costs, and increased regulatory oversight are pushing many non-profits toward consolidation.
Mergers in the sector were once taboo — now they are increasingly necessary.
Drivers include:
• Financial instability
• Duplicated services in crowded markets
• Increasing funder pressure for coordination
• Desire for stronger back-office capabilities
• Need for scale to measure and report impact
• Talent shortages that prevent growth
• Regional fragmentation of services
But most non-profits are unprepared for mergers because they lack:
• Integration playbooks
• Governance agreements
• Cultural alignment plans
• Risk assessments
• Shared-service models
• Financial modelling
• Stakeholder communication frameworks
Consolidation will accelerate. The question is not whether non-profits should merge — but whether they are ready to merge on their terms.
